XOMA Prices $35 Million Offering of Depositary Shares
Depositary shares represent an interest in 8.375% Series B Cumulative Perpetual Preferred Stock
EMERYVILLE, Calif., April 06,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) XOMA Corporation (Nasdaq: XOMA) (“XOMA” or the “Company”) today announced the pricing of its underwritten registered public offering of 1,400,000 depositary shares at an initial public offering price of $25.00 per depositary share, raising gross proceeds of $35.0 million before deducting underwriting discounts and other estimated offering expenses.  Each depositary share represents a 1/1000
th fractional interest in a share of the Company’s 8.375% Series B Cumulative Perpetual Preferred Stock.  Dividends on the Series B Preferred Stock underlying the depositary shares will be paid when declared by the Board at a fixed rate of 8.375% with liquidation preference equivalent to $25.00 per depositary share. ....

XOMA Reports Fourth Quarter and Full-Year 2020 Financial Results and Operating Highlights


Published: Mar 10, 2021
Recognized revenue of $29.4 million 
Six assets in the Company’s milestone and royalty portfolio advanced to Phase 2 clinical development 
Completed $24.6 million Series A Perpetual Preferred Stock offering paying a 8.625% dividend 
Ended 2020 with $84.2 million in cash
EMERYVILLE, Calif., March 10,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) XOMA Corporation (Nasdaq: XOMA) announced its fourth quarter and full-year 2020 financial results and business highlights.

XOMA Announces Exercise of Green Shoe Option and Closes Preferred Stock Offering

EMERYVILLE, Calif., Dec. 21, 2020 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) XOMA Corporation (Nasdaq: XOMA) (“XOMA” or the “Company”) today announced the closing of its previously announced underwritten registered public offering of 984,000 shares, which includes the underwriters option to purchase additional 104,000 shares of its 8.625% Series A Cumulative Perpetual Preferred Stock, with liquidation preference of $25.00 per share (the “Preferred Stock”), at an initial public offering price of $25.00 per share. The offering resulted in net proceeds of approximately $23.4 million after deducting underwriting discounts and commissions, but before deducting expenses and the structuring fee.
